Specific Duties:
- Perform security duties at various locations including the main campus and offsite locations (including patrolling, crowd control, unlocking/locking buildings, arming/disarming alarms, monitoring CCTV system).
- File incident reports in a timely manner. Completion of incident reports to possibly include accessing, reviewing, and providing pictures and/or video from surveillance systems to local authorities and/or SVdP departments.
- Perform essential operational duties as needed on all properties when volunteers are not present or able to be on property (Trash removal, sweeping, mopping, serving, stacking tables or chairs)
- Respond to emergency incidents, provide support, and take lead in providing life saving measures like CPR, AED, First-Aid, and/or Naloxone or Epinephrine injections.
- Observe staff, volunteers, and guests to ensure everyone displays a pass or a company badge to be on property. Ensure all people on property are following any health and safety guidelines set by SVdP.
- Monitor employees, volunteers and client volunteers performing duties in their assigned area/s or department. Investigate any suspicious behavior by individuals on property or in surrounding areas.
- Professionally handle disputes on property and take appropriate action and measures including removal of individuals and/or initiate contact with proper emergency response agencies. Demonstrate de-escalation techniques and care for post incident occurrences.
- Display professional behavior in all situations. Maintain good working relationships with all staff, volunteers, and clients. Assist all department managers, supervisors, or assistant supervisors with personnel, volunteer, or guest conflicts.
- Perform other duties assigned by Security Manager/Supervisor
